II SISTEMI
SISTEMI INFORMATIVI
INFORMATIVI
INTEGRATI
INTEGRATI
Baan
Baan IV
IV -- Funzionalità
Funzionalità ee Architettura
Architettura
✍
NOTE
Baan
Baan Company:
Company: profilo
profilo
•
•
•
•
•
•
Fondata nel 1978
Oltre 2000 clienti nel mondo
Oltre 1500 dipendenti
Fatturato 1995: 216 (milioni di $)
76% di crescita nel 1995
Sedi principali: Ede (NL) & Menlo Park
(USA)
• Presente in 58 paesi
• Quotata al NASDAQ a Wall Street e alla
Borsa Merci di Amsterdam
Fondata nel 1978 da Jan Baan.
Oltre 2000 clienti nel mondo.
Oltre 1500 dipendenti.
Un fatturato nel 1995 di 216
milioni di dollari, con un
incremento del 76%.
Sedi principali: Ede (NL) &
Menlo Park (CALIFORNIA,
USA).
La Baan Company distribuisce il
software attraverso una estesa rete
di
consociate
(distribuzione
diretta) e di concessionari
(distribuzione indiretta).
✍
NOTE
La
Lapresenza
presenza Baan
Baannel
nel mondo
mondo
Argentina
Australia
Austria
Belgium
Brazil
Bulgaria
Canada
Chile
China
Colombia
Czech Republic
Denmark
Ecuador
Egypt
Finland
France
Germany
Greece
Hong Kong
India
Indonesia
•
Israel
•
Italy
2 Sedi principali: Ede (NL) & Menlo Park (USA)
22 Paesi con filiali dirette
• 36 Paesi con distributori autorizzati locali
• 3 Centri di sviluppo (India - US - NL)
✍
Japan
Malaysia
Mexico
The
Netherlands
New Zealand
Norway
The Philippines
Poland
Portugal
Russia
Saudia Arabia
Singapore
Slovenia
South Africa
Spain
Sweden
Switzerland
Taiwan
Thailand
Turkey
United Arab
Emirates
United Kingdom
U.S.A.
Venezuela
NOTE
Aree
Aree d’Intervento
d’Intervento
CONTROLLO
DI GESTIONE
VENDITE
MKT
Database
Tecnologico
DOCUMENTAZIONE
TECNICA
CAD 2D
AMMINISTRAZIONE
CONTABILITÀ'
GENERALE
LAY-OUT
PROGETTAZIONE
PROGETTAZIONE
ACQUISTI
MAGAZZINO
TESTING
CAD 3D
DISTINTA BASE
DATI TECNICI
CICLI E
FASI
CAM
DNC
PRODUZIONE
PRODUZIONE
MRP I
MRP II
LOTTI E
COMMESSE
✍
NOTE
Innovazione
Innovazioneee Cambiamento
Cambiamento
Dynamic
DynamicEnterprise
EnterpriseModeling
Modeling
Enterprise
EnterpriseResource
ResourcePlanning
Planning
ERP
ERP
MRP
MRP II
II
MRP
MRP
DEM
DEM
Manufactoring
ManufactoringResource
ResourcePlanning
Planning
Materials
MaterialsRequirement
RequirementPlanning
Planning
Inventory
Inventory
Control
Control
1960
1970
1980
Il software Enterprise Resource
Planning (ERP) offre ad un'azienda
un'efficiente gestione della catena di
servizi a tutti i livelli operativi del
cliente. Ora, la Baan presenta un nuova
concezione di business management
software che include e supera l'ERP.
Tale concezione è denominata
Dynamic Enterprise Modeling (DEM).
Con l’uso di DEM le aziende sono in
grado di accoppiare i loro processi
operativi con le provate ed estese
funzionalità degli Applicativi. Il
prodotto fornito dalla Baan è chiamato
BAAN IV ed é un sistema informativo
tecnologico che integra i dati
estrapolati dai vari processi, costruendo
un chiara e completa visione del flusso
delle informazioni operative.
1990
✍
2000
NOTE
La
La Strategia
Strategia
(cont.)
(cont.)
z MODELLO DINAMICO DELL’AZIENDA
(D.E.M.: Dynamic Enterprise Modeling)
z UNA SERIE DI MODULI APPLICATIVI INTEGRATI
z UNA METODOLOGIA DI IMPLEMENTAZIONE
z UN AMBIENTE DI SVILUPPO DI 3a E 4a GENERAZIONE
z IMPLEMENTAZIONE CERTIFICATA
z GARANZIA DI EVOLUZIONE NEL TEMPO
z CERTIFICAZIONE ISO 9002
Dynamic Enterprise Modeling:
Supporta il miglioramento continuo del processo operativo
dell'azienda, soddisfacendo le necessità dell'organizzazione, degli
utenti e della catena di rifornimento attraverso un'ottica
informatizzata che permette l'adozione di una tecnologia in
evoluzione.
- focalizzazione sulle funzioni e sui processi di business
- configurazione automatica
- implementazione rapida
- miglioramento continuo
- integrazione tra Business e la catena delle forniture
Orgware: Un insieme di strumenti per la modellizazione
dell’organizzazione
Desktop: configurazione, generazione di procedure di workflow,
Windows 95, Windows NT, X-Windows e ASCII
Internet: attivazione dei messaggi e-mail, supporti informativi
per i fornitori, supporto ad attività di marketing, uso di Java come
supporto ai processi operativi critici
Applications: collaborazione con industrie leader, gestione della
catena di forniture, modelli produttivi misti, integrazione con i
partner
Tools & Architecture: architettura completamente aperta, sistemi
scalabili, tre livelli di client/server
✍
NOTE
La
La Strategia
Strategia
• Sistemi Aperti
• Architettura Client/Server
• Rapida Implementazione
• Flessibilità, Configurabilità
• Scalabilità
• Supporto di Processi Ibridi
• Multi-sito, Multi-aziendale, Multi-nazionale
Integrazione dei Componenti
✍
La Componente Tecnologica, i vari pacchetti applicativi eNOTE
gli strumenti e
gli strumenti (Orgware Factory) sono completamente integrati.
Il Modello Client/Server e i Database
Il sistema è implementato secondo il tipo di architettura Client/Server a tre
livelli (three-tier): 1) la gestione dei dati (Data Management), tipicamente
un DBMS (Data Base Management System), 2) l’applicazione vera e
propria (Application Function) dedicata all’elaborazione dei dati secondo
il modello applicativo specifico e 3) la presentazione dei risultati di
un'elaborazione o la richiesta di dati (Presentation) secondo le esigenze
dell’utente (maschere piuttosto che tabelle o grafici etc.).
In Triton le funzionalità di Server sono implementate su sistemi operativi
UNIX di fornitori diversi (es. IBM, HP). La parte Client (Presentation e
parte dell’applicazione) può essere un semplice terminale, un terminale
UNIX con interfaccia X-Terminal o Motif o ancora un Personal Computer
in ambienti Windows ‘95 o Windows NT.
Per la gestione dei DataBase Triton offre un suo sistema proprietario
(Triton Data) ma supporta anche DBMS di altri fornitori quali Oracle,
Informix On-Line, Ingres e Sybase.
Applicazioni
Applicazioni eeStrumenti
Strumenti
Enterprise
(Impresa)
Distribution
(Distribuzione)
Service
Finance
(Finanza)
Organizer
Organizer
(Organizzatore)
(Organizzatore)
Project
(Servizi)
(Progetti)
Manufacturing
Automotive
Transportation
(Fabbricazione)
(Automobilistico)
(Trasporti)
Tools
(Strumenti)
✍
Architettura del Sistema
Il sistema Triton, come riportato in figura, è composto da 3 macro componenti
funzionali integrati: una Componente Tecnologica, un insieme di pacchetti
applicativi
NOTE
(Software Factory) ed un insieme di strumenti a supporto della realizzazione di un
progetto Triton (Orgware Factory)(1).
La Componente Tecnologica ha la funzione di disaccoppiare il software applicativo e
gli strumenti dalle specifiche caratteristiche tecnologiche del sistema operativo
(OS=Operating System) e della gestione della rete (NOS=Network Operating System).
In questo modo l’evoluzione tecnologica dei sistemi operativi ed anche la migrazione
verso altri sistemi ha un minimo impatto sulle altre componenti.
La Software Factory è un insieme di applicazioni che si rivolgono a specifici settori di
business e possono operare singolarmente od in modo integrato. Per fare alcuni esempi:
• Finance è si rivolge alla gestione economico finanziaria dell’azienda;
• Manufactoring è lo strumento a supporto della produzione per diverse tipologie
produttive quali “progettazione su ordine”, “assemblaggio su ordine”, “produzione
per magazzino”.
• Distribution è un sistema di logistica comprendente la gestione delle vendite, degli
acquisti, dei contratti, delle scorte e delle ubicazioni, etc...
L’Orgware Factory è un insieme di strumenti di tipo sia organizzativo che
implementativo che aiutano nella definizione e conduzione del progetto introduttivo di
Triton.
Architettura
Architettura Aperta
Aperta
deposito
deposito dei
dei dati
dati
ee delle
configurazioni
delle configurazioni
ambienti
ambienti di
di
presentazione
presentazione Controllo della
Controllo della
logica
logica applicativa
applicativa
Windows95
WindowsNT
X-Windows
ASCII
Controllo
Controllo dell’interfaccia
dell’interfaccia
grafica
grafica d’utente
d’utente
GUI
driver
Repository
Gestore
Gestore della
della
base
base dati
dati
relazionale
relazionale
Controllo
Controllo della
della
base
base dati
dati
RDBMS
Logic
Server
DB
driver
Operating System
UNIX (& NT)
Oracle
Informix
(DB2/6000
SQL Server)
sistema
sistema
operativo
operativo
✍
La famiglia dei software Baan è basata su di un sistema aperto
con architettura client/server che offre un'ampia gamma di
NOTEvarietà
possibilità implementative. Il sistema supporta una grande
di software e di piattaforme hardware -da UNIX a NT ed ai
database relazionali, alle workstations grafiche ed alle periferiche
ASCII -offrendo l'opportunità di scegliere la tecnologia più
funzionale per la soddisfazione delle più svariate necessità.
L'architettura del software assicura una facilità di gestione e di
adattabilità alle nuove tecnologie. Le applicazioni sono gestite
attraverso il Baan Shell, che provvede all'interfacciamento nelle
piattaforme -attraverso software drivers. Con tale architettura, le
applicazioni possono essere utilizzate su di un nuovo hardware,
sistema operativo, database, rete ed interfaccia senza nessuna
modifica ai codici di configurazione.
Versatilità, Flessibilità, Espandibilità